MF03 UTP is a 2003 Mazda Demio in Silver with a 1,323c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 19 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 68.4%.
Across all 2003 Mazda Demio models, the average MOT pass rate is 74.7% with a typical mileage of 51,132 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mazda Demio f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 7,070 recorded failures. If you're considering buying MF03 UTP,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da Demio typ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 23 years old, this Mazda Demio is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
